What's the difference between the Sonata Sport and Sport 2.0T? The Sport has a 1.6L turbo engine with 178 hp and dual-clutch transmission, while the Sport 2.0T features a more powerful 2.0L turbo with 245 hp, Brembo brakes, 19" wheels, and enhanced suspension tuning for serious performance.
How reliable is the 2017 Hyundai Sonata Sport? The 2017 Sonata Sport is generally reliable, with the 1.6L turbo engine proving dependable in most applications. Hyundai's comprehensive warranty provides excellent protection for any potential issues.
What's the fuel economy of the turbocharged Sonata Sport? The 1.6L turbo Sport achieves 24 city/32 highway MPG, while the 2.0L Sport 2.0T gets 23 city/32 highway MPG, both offering good efficiency for turbocharged performance.
Does the 2017 Sonata Sport have Apple CarPlay and Android Auto? Yes, Android Auto and Apple CarPlay are available on 2017 Sonata models equipped with the 8" touchscreen infotainment system, providing seamless smartphone integration.
How does the dual-clutch transmission perform in the Sport trim? The 7-speed dual-clutch transmission in the Sport provides quick shifts and sporty feel, though it can be slightly jerky at low speeds compared to traditional automatics.
What safety features come standard on the 2017 Sonata Sport? Standard safety features include Vehicle Stability Management, Traction Control, Electronic Brake-force Distribution, Brake Assist, and Tire Pressure Monitoring. Blind Spot Detection is available on higher trims.
Is the Sonata Sport good for highway driving? Yes, the turbocharged engines provide strong highway acceleration and passing power, while the comfortable seats and quiet cabin make longer drives enjoyable.
How much trunk space does the 2017 Sonata have? The Sonata offers 16.3 cubic feet of trunk space, which is competitive in the midsize sedan class and adequate for luggage, groceries, and everyday cargo needs.
What's the difference between Sport and Limited trims? The Sport focuses on performance with turbo engine and sport suspension, while the Limited emphasizes luxury with leather seats, premium audio, and convenience features using the naturally aspirated engine.
How does the 2017 Sonata Sport compare to competitors? The Sonata Sport offers competitive turbocharged performance, generous warranty coverage, and spacious interior compared to rivals like the Honda Accord Sport, Toyota Camry, and Nissan Altima, with strong value pricing.
